The Phocaeans won against Reims (4-1).
New coach Igor Tudor's tactics seem to be working despite some misunderstandings within the player ranks.
As for Brest, despite the defeat (3-2), the players had a good match against Lens.
This meeting, refereed by Jérémy Stinat, will be marked by the arrival of the new Brest central defender, Josué Escartin.

Brest – Marseille: at what time and on which channel?
The Brest – Marseille match takes place this Sunday evening from 8:45 p.m., live on
the Le Pass Ligue 1 channel via Amazon Prime Video
.
You will find Thibault Le Rol, who presents the match, the compositions and the stakes.
Then, the teams of reporter commentators will take over to show you the match from the Francis-Le Blé stadium.
Just before the match, Marina Lorenzo will recap with you the highlights of the day of the championship in the program “Dimanche Soir Football”.
